    Dynamism of a Dog on a Leash (Italian: Dinamismo di un cane al guinzaglio), sometimes called Dog on a Leash [2] or Leash in Motion, [3] is a 1912 oil painting by Italian Futurist painter Giacomo Balla. [4] It was influenced by the artist's fascination with chronophotographic studies of animals in motion.

    In modern times, the Chinantecs and Mixes of Oaxaca believe that a black dog will help the newly dead to cross a body of water, either a river or a sea, to the land of the dead. [20] [21] The Huitzilan believe that a dog carries the dead across the water to reach the underworld home of the Devil. [2]
